Abstract

684,814. Change-speed gearing. STOECKICHT, W. G. Feb. 27, 1951 [Aug. 30, 1950] , No. 4726/51. Class 80 (ii). A change-speed gear giving two forward and one reverse speeds comprises two epicyclic gear sets, the annulus 6 of the first set being coupled to the engine shaft 4, the carrier 13 of the second set constituting the driven member of the double gear, the carrier 8 of the first set being coupled to the annulus 11. of the second set and the two suns 9, 14 being formed on a common sleeve 15. Reduced forward speed is obtained by applying a brake 24 to the member 15, direct drive by engaging a fluid-actuated clutch 26 between the annulus 6 and the carrier 13, and reduced reverse drive by applying a brake 23 to the carrier 8. As shown, the carrier 13 drives the final driven shaft 20 through an additional epicyclic. gear of which the annulus 18 is coupled to the carrier 13, carrier 19 is integral with shaft 20, a brake 25 being adapted to be applied to sun 22 or a fluid-actuated clutch 27 engaged between sun 22 and carrier 19 so as to afford two additional reduced forward speeds. Alternatively, the additional gear set 18, 19, 22 may be arranged ahead of the double gear set and may be replaced by a hydraulic torque converter.
